Conclusion
         The significance of the connection between math and astronomy is an obvious one.

Math, the most powerful tool on earth, is used in virtually every field of study, especially

astronomy. The applications of math have furthured the study of space and what inhabits

it, possibly more than all other factors combined. To answer "What is astronomy?", one

must first know what mathematics is. That is how significant their connection really is.


          Great minds such as Galileo Galilei and Johannes Kepler used mathematics to

further the world's knowledge of astronomy. During their lives they applied math to

astronomy and vice versa to discover laws and principles that still play major roles in

modern applications of mathematics and modern astronomy. Without man their research

in astronomy would have been fruitless. Their roles in math and astronomy is so significant

that NASA, the most technologically advanced space program. has recognized them by

creating high-tech space observation tools that bear their names.
